Camoranesi Pondering Idea Of Playing In Serie B

The World Champion might remain with Juventus.


With many Bianconeri players leaving Turin for better pastures in the past days, Mauro German Camoranesi might decide to stay with the Old Lady even in the lower division.

According to transfer speculations, Camoranesi has received various offers from Spanish clubs, but according to the latest reports from Italy, the international player might decide to remain with Juventus if there is a discount on the -30 points inflicted on the Bianconeri in Serie B.

In the mean time, this week Juventus should finalize the deals which will send Vieira, Ibrahimovic and Trezeguet away from Turin.
